    Title: File-Find-Rule: Shell Injection
     Date: June 12, 2025
     Bugs: #957182
       ID: 202506-10

- -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- -

Synopsis
========

A vulnerability has been discovered in File-Find-Rule, which can lead to
shell injection.

Background
==========

File-Find-Rule is an alternative interface to File::Find.

Affected packages
=================

Package                  Vulnerable    Unaffected
-----------------------  ------------  ------------
dev-perl/File-Find-Rule  < 0.350.0     >= 0.350.0

Description
===========

File-Find-Rule uses the legacy '2-arg' open() call which is susceptible
to shell injection via malicious filenames.

Impact
======

Shell injection may be used to execute arbitrary code using a malicious
filename.

Workaround
==========

There is no known workaround at this time.

Resolution
==========

All File-Find-Rule users should upgrade to the latest version:

  # emerge --sync
  # emerge --ask --oneshot --verbose ">=dev-perl/File-Find-Rule-0.350.0"
